Description

Bill Earle (pictured here with his wife, Nancy) was elected on April 3, 1966 to complete the first five-member city council, along with Ted Dela Court, Michael Jackson, George Bonner, and Jim Hughes. After leaving the council in the late 60s, Earle continued to make a difference in the planning of Palm Beach Gardens City Hall before eventually relocating to Huddleston, Virginia. He is pictured here at the Commemoration of the City Hall Planning.
